Transaction 5baab332230df3219126ff0563017ae048a1add33dffc52489d07b5d1a1a8ae5
1 Input
1 Output
-
5baab332230df3219126ff0563017ae048a1add33dffc52489d07b5d1a1a8ae5:0
- value
- 51750
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89cc7de54fcc3c231cbda0631a77296d7059b649 OP_EQUAL
- address
- 3EFdUANuzu6STfNRREsLEEYUEHCR3WGS7N